Beehive (Symbol)

  1. A symbol of industry, cooperation, and hard work, embraced by the pioneers and woven through Latter-day Saint and Utah imagery.

From the Book of Mormon word "deseret" (honeybee), the beehive appears on Utah's state emblem, on temples, and in Church art, representing a whole community working together.
